August 12, 2024
Has Brooks Koepka won the Masters? Best finishes at Augusta for LIV Golf star
There aren’t many names in the golf world that require your attention. That’s reserved for a handful of players, who typically sit atop the leaderboard every week. Few names can overcome that andRead More